1. L1800 DTF Printer – Best Overall Budget Pick

The L1800 has become a favorite among small apparel brands — and for good reason. It’s affordable, dependable, and perfect for creators who want to get started without a heavy upfront investment.

Why It Stands Out

  • Smooth, consistent color output

  • Great for beginners and new T-shirt brands

  • Low maintenance with readily available parts

Best For: Solo entrepreneurs and small shops printing 10–30 shirts per day.


2. Epson XP-600 DTF Printer – Best for High-Detail Prints

If sharp detail and color accuracy matter to you, the XP-600 delivers impressive results for a budget model.

Top Features

  • Fast printing speed compared to similar budget printers

  • Excellent image clarity

  • Works seamlessly with most DTF inks and films

Best For: Designers who prioritize sharp, photorealistic prints.
